The most racially diverse public high schools in McKinley County, New Mexico

9 public high schools in McKinley County, New Mexico appear in this ranking of the most racially diverse public high schools, ranked by how small the single largest racial or ethnic group is, so no one group dominates. GALLUP CENTRAL ALTERNATIVE leads the list at 57.1%, against a median of 88.4% across the ranked schools.

The table below is sortable and filterable, and the full list downloads as a CSV. Figures come from federal NCES enrollment data and, where applicable, state assessment results for 2024-25.
